Common Music release 2.4.1 is available for download from sourceforge
and CCRMA:

I will make a binary release for OSX in a day or so.
This is the release that I'm burning on the CD to accompanying the book
Notes from the Metalevel. Ive tested all of the book examples with the
release before uploading the tarballs.
Most of work for 2.4.1 went into simplifying the install for CM and
using it with CLM and CMN. The release contains a brand new startup
script bin/cm.sh that will do every thing for you -- install and/or run
CM in any supported lisp from a terminal or under X/Emacs. I can't
thank Tobias enough for writing it.
